Description
Seize the rare opportunity to purchase the personal residence of one of Philadelphia's most respected designers. This incredible home located in the renowned Tredyffrin-Easttown school district and just minutes away from countless private schools, has been completely reimagined and impeccably crafted over the past 3 years, seamlessly blending timeless yet trend-setting concepts, fabulous materials, stunning fixtures and beautiful finishes throughout. The bright, sun-filled spaces offer a wonderful open flow with serene views of the breathtaking gardens, stone terraces and expansive walkable neighborhood from every window. Features include beautifully refinished hardwood floors and classic molding details, high ceilings, spacious living and dining rooms, a generous 1st floor office with private vistas, fabulous gourmet kitchen with coffee bar, adjacent breakfast room and expansive family room, Four Seasons level Primary Suite with spa-like bathroom, two enormous custom outfitted dressing rooms and every amenity, 2nd bedroom with en-suite bathroom and 3rd and 4th bedrooms (the 4th bedroom currently configured as a fully outfitted top-level dressing room) with an additional re-designed 3rd bathroom, 2nd floor laundry incredible fully finished walk-out lower level with additional office space, media/ wet bar entertainment room, gym, wrapping room, 2nd powder room and lots of dry storage. This one of a kind package is just minutes away from endless recreational facilities, equestrian centers, golf and racket clubs, hiking trails, all forms of transportation, renowned schools and universities and more.
